TECHNICAL GUIDE
COMMERCIAL
SPLIT-SYSTEM COOLING UNITS
FOUR PIPE SYSTEM
MODELS HB 180 & HB 240
MODELS LB 180 & LB 240
15 & 20 NOMINAL TONS
9.7 EER
®
GENERAL SPECIFICATIONS
OUTDOOR UNIT:
Two independent refrigerant circuits
Inherently protected fan motors
Two independent scroll compressors
V-Coil Design
Exterior service port connections
Refrigerant-22 holding charge
Five-minute compressor anti-short cycle timer
Two independent control circuits
Compressor operation to 40°F
Field-installed Low Ambient VFD Control to 0°F
Five-year limited warranty on compressor
One-year limited warranty on all other parts
Simplicity Controls
Factory installed disconnect and Technicoat coils
INDOOR UNIT:
Factory-mounted expansion valve and filter-drier in both
refrigerant circuit
Adjustable TXV’s
Two-inch throwaway filters
Single point power connection
One-year limited warranty on all parts
Field installed drive packages
